The Message--Christ--and Fruitage 

Let us sound the cry that the time has come to attempt more for God and expect more from Him in the way of fruitage. Along with that we must emphasize the necessity of not preaching the bare bones of the message, but having an unction from on high and preaching Christ in it. A man who preaches the message without Christ, I take it, is not preaching the message. 

A man who preaches Christ without the message is not preaching Christ properly. It is Christ's message, described in Revelation 14, "having the everIasting gospei to preach." Let us preach it, and sound the call for everybody to preach it.--From the devotional hour at a recent Council
